Container terminals must stay relevant as we move into the next decade as competition heightens. Uno Bryfors, Senior Vice President of ABB Ports, talks to the Port Technology International team about how terminals survive. 
Automation is one of the means terminals can deploy to keep pace with their competitors and Bryfors notes that no terminal will be able to survive completely without automation. 
ABB has extensive track record of automating container terminals around the world – from ship to gate. Currently the company has for instance over 900 automated stacking crane systems delivered to terminals across the globe.
